Khabib Nurmagomedov will face off against Justin Gaethje at UFC 254 on Saturday afternoon to defend his lightweight championship. It is expected to be a fun bout between two contrasting styles that will settle once and for all who the division’s best fighter is.

Heading into the match-up, both men had to weigh in on Friday morning. Gaethje did the deed with no issues or concerns. Nurmagomedov, however, seemed to have some difficulties.

Unlike his counterpart, Nurmagomedov appeared to go extremely quickly with no one paying serious attention to whether his weight was actually on the mark. The video speaks for itself.

The person conducting the weigh-in could very clearly be seen not paying attention to what was actually on Nurmagomedov’s scale.
